Please READ this box for more info. Do you know what's your body shape? This video will show you the 6 basic female body shapes and how you can plan your workout according to your body shape to see results.

The 6 basic female body shapes are:
1) A Frame (Pear Shape)
2) V Frame (Apple Shape)
3) H Frame (Athletic Build)
4) Ruler Frame (Skinny)
5) 8 Frame (Hour Glass)
6) Oval Frame

Learn what and how much cardio and strength workout you need to do and which area to focus on according to your body shape.

The shape of your body is a direct result of your genes and your lifestyle. So embrace parts of your body that you can't change. Give your body the best fuel and exercise it needs & most importantly respect your body.
